Exeter Community Food Network
The Exeter Community Food Network brings together groups/services offering free and low-cost food across the city. The network aims to better understand the provision offered; the needs and issues faced by the people using them; and collaborating and sharing experiences in addressing food need in Exeter.


Exeter Digital Inclusion Network
The Exeter Digital Inclusion Network is open to individuals or organisations with an interest in helping local residents to overcome barriers to digital inclusion; sharing knowledge of those in need; and offering potential solutions. Representatives from community spaces, GP practices, libraries and support charities have joined the network. This partnership has led to the recent launch of our Digital Buddy Volunteering campaign.
Community Centres Network
This network provides peer support opportunities for the managers, trustees and volunteers that run our multi-use community facilities across Exeter.
The Community Centres Network also organises guest speakers offering expertise on topics of interest to the network. For example, a representative of Exeter Community Energy shared their offer to provide energy efficiency drop-in events for local residents in order to help them address soaring utility bills.

Social Enterprise Network
Set up to take forward the work of ESSENCE, the Social Enterprise Network aims to give enterprises the chance to get support, network and learn from each other.
There is a growing community of amazing social and community enterprises in Exeter who are achieving an impressive positive impact for people and our planet.
- A space for like-minded people to network in real life.
- Enable collaboration and peer support.
- Celebrate achievements and aspirations.
- Explore solutions to common development challenges.

Ward Stakeholders Lunches
We host several quarterly lunch meet-ups for wards in the City. It’s a great way for community leaders and councillors in a ward to get together for networking and sharing news. Currently these are being held in Beacon Heath, St Thomas and Pinhoe.
